Здравствуйте, landerhigh, Вы писали:
S>>Кого-то просили привести пример преимущества короутин над КА, но кто-то что-то проигнорировал.
L>Так пример привели. И не один
Ни одного нормального пока не видел. Особенно если вспомнить про вложенные состояния для КА, обработчики входа/выхода и пр. лабуду.
L>С точки зрения обсуждаемой темы (запись асинхроного автомата в виде синхронного кода) единственное преимущество стековых корутин в том, что собственно код алгоритма будет написан вообще без co_yield, так yield будет вызываться внтури собственно кода который оборачивает I/O (где, собственно, асинхронность и возникает).
Именно.
L>Мое, основанное на личном опыте, мнение — не стоит.